I just received this book.

It includes a Foreword written by fellow “Bad guy” Rick Boyd. (1. Page)
An Introduction written by the author (2. pages)
A Biography (6. pages) that includes several pictures.

The bulk of the book consists of a survey of the films that Luciano Rossi starred in. (103. pages)
This material includes a text to all films presented, some only get a few lines, but most get half a page or more.
Besides that the survey is chock-full of pictures and posters from all the films.

Finally the book also has a helpful Index (4. pages)

I highly recommended this book. The survey alone with all it’s pictures and posters of well known films, and some lesser known, makes this a reference guide to Italian cult films.

Luciano Rossi is one of my favorite character actors in italian westerns and especially in cop films and gialli. He’s almost always playing some crazed villains, perverts and loonies. He is so great in Death walks in midnight.

His greatest role in spaghetti westerns must be the villain in django the Bastard.
